Inconel X-750
VerifiedmetalInconel X-750 is a nickel-based superalloy strengthened by gamma-prime precipitation, designed for high-temperature aerospace applications requiring sustained strength to approximately 1300°F (704°C). The alloy exhibits excellent creep resistance, fatigue strength, and corrosion resistance in jet engine components, gas turbine blades, and fasteners, with the Equalized and Aged temper providing optimal strength development through controlled solution treatment and precipitation hardening.
